Panga collects 16.50 cr in Week 1

PANGA had a dull first week as it collected 16.50 crore nett in week one and this figure is 10 crore less than CHHAPAAK which itself had a poor number. The film was struggling from the start though got huge growth on day two as there was help from the media coupled with a very low first day which enabled the growth. But eventually the public word of mouth would come out and that is what happened on Sunday as it could not really consolidate the growth.
There was a chance of respectability if the film could have improved its Friday collections on Monday by around 20-25% but it fell around 40% which meant lights out. The weekdays continued to drop by small amounts and now the task is probably to get over the 25 crore nett mark as even a 30 crore nett total looks impossible even with the weak competition. Now that is really asking for trouble as you don't have an audience anyway and you think the wider audience is mad to watch your poor cinema over the bigger films.
The collections of PANGA till date are as follows.
Friday - 2,00,00,000
Saturday - 4,25,00,000
Sunday - 5,50,00,000 apprx
Monday - 1,25,00,000 apprx
Tuesday - 1,20,00,000 apprx
Wednesday - 1,20,00,000 apprx
Thursday - 1,10,00,000 apprx
TOTAL - 16,50,00,000 apprx
